According to a report, the u.s. are to send $800 million of military assistance to Ukraine to bolster its defensive in the east. Reportedly, the new package of assistance will contain many of the highly effective weapons systems already provided.
According to the report, the ukrainian deputy defence minister said it was possible that phosphorus munitions had been used in Mariupol. Reportedly, phosphorus munitions are not classed as chemical weapons but are banned in civilian areas where firing would expose people to fumes and could breach the chemical weapons convention.
According to a report, russian missile strikes hit Kyiv and other cities on Saturday. Reportedly, the retreat of russian troops from towns around Kyiv have exposed the killing and execution of civilians, including women.
